TOP
|
特許
|
意匠
|
商標
特許ウォッチ
Twitter
他の特許を見る
公開番号
2025011567
公報種別
公開特許公報(A)
公開日
2025-01-24
出願番号
2023113754
出願日
2023-07-11
発明の名称
エミュレーションシステム
出願人
株式会社デンソー
代理人
弁理士法人サトー
主分類
G06F
9/455 20180101AFI20250117BHJP(計算;計数)
要約
【課題】複数種類のデータが階層構造により格納されているデータベースからエミュレーションに必要なデータを取得する場合において、エミュレーションに必要なデータが不足した状態でエミュレーションが実行されてしまうことを回避する。
【解決手段】実機における動作を実機以外の動作環境においてエミュレーションするエミュレーションシステム10は、複数種類のデータが階層構造により格納されているデータベース12と、エミュレーションに必要なデータをデータベースから取得する取得部21と、取得部により取得されたデータを用いてエミュレーションを実行する実行部22と、エミュレーションに必要な全てのデータのうち取得部により取得されていない不足データが存在するか否かを確認する確認部23と、を備え、実行部は、確認部により不足データが存在しないことが確認されると、エミュレーションを実行する。
【選択図】図4
特許請求の範囲
【請求項1】
実機における動作を実機以外の動作環境においてエミュレーションするエミュレーションシステム(10)であって、
複数種類のデータが階層構造により格納されているデータベース(12)と、
前記エミュレーションに必要なデータを前記データベースから取得する取得部(21)と、
前記取得部により取得されたデータを用いて前記エミュレーションを実行する実行部(22)と、
前記エミュレーションに必要な全てのデータのうち前記取得部により取得されていない不足データが存在するか否かを確認する確認部(23)と、
を備え、
前記実行部は、前記確認部により前記不足データが存在しないことが確認されると、前記エミュレーションを実行するエミュレーションシステム。
続きを表示(約 640 文字)
【請求項2】
前記取得部は、前記確認部により前記不足データが存在することが確認されると、当該不足データに類似する類似データを前記データベースから取得し、
前記実行部は、前記取得部により取得された前記類似データを前記不足データの代替データとして用いて前記エミュレーションを実行する請求項1に記載のエミュレーションシステム。
【請求項3】
前記取得部は、前記確認部により前記不足データが存在することが確認されると、当該不足データに類似する複数の類似データを前記データベースから取得し、
前記実行部は、前記取得部により取得された複数の前記類似データから選択した類似データを前記不足データの代替データとして用いて前記エミュレーションを実行する請求項2に記載のエミュレーションシステム。
【請求項4】
前記エミュレーション実行時において前記実行部が用いたデータを過去データとして記憶する記憶部(24)と、
前記実行部が実行しようとする前記エミュレーションに必要なデータのうち前記過去データ以外のデータを差分データとして特定する特定部(25)と、
を備え、
前記取得部は、前記差分データを前記データベースから新たに取得し、
前記実行部は、前記記憶部により記憶されている前記過去データと前記取得部により新たに取得された前記差分データを用いて前記エミュレーションを実行する請求項1に記載のエミュレーションシステム。
発明の詳細な説明
【技術分野】
【0001】
本開示は、実機における動作を実機以外の動作環境においてエミュレーションするエミュレーションシステムに関する。
続きを表示(約 2,100 文字)
【背景技術】
【0002】
実機における動作を実機以外の動作環境において仮想検証するシステム、いわゆるエミュレーションシステムの開発が進められている。例えば特許文献1には、エミュレーションを実行するエミュレーションプログラムのコンテナを制御装置やサーバに配備して仮想検証を行うシステムが開示されている。
【先行技術文献】
【特許文献】
【0003】
特開2022-91301号公報
【発明の概要】
【発明が解決しようとする課題】
【0004】
近年では、例えば機械設備やロボットなどといった実機の構造や動作が複雑化しており、これに伴い、エミュレーションに必要なデータも多種多様となり、データの複雑化や膨大化を招いている。このような事情を背景として、近年では、複数種類のデータが階層構造により整理された状態で格納されているデータベース、例えばPLMデータベース(PLM:Product Lifecycle Management/製品ライフサイクル管理)からエミュレーションに必要な各種のデータを取得してエミュレーションに用いることが考えられている。この手法によれば、多種多様となり複雑化や膨大化しているデータ群から必要なデータを効率良く取得してエミュレーションを行うことができ、エミュレーションの設定やエミュレーション自体の効率化や迅速化を図ることができる。
【0005】
しかしながら、例えばPLMデータベースなどといった複数種類のデータが階層構造により整理された状態で格納されているデータベースからデータを取得するとしても、必ずしもエミュレーションに必要な全てのデータを取得できるわけではなく、エミュレーションに必要な全てのデータが揃わず不足した状態となる場合も発生し得る。このようにデータが不足した状態では、仮にエミュレーションを実行したとしても、仮想検証を精度良く行うことは困難である。
【0006】
本開示は、複数種類のデータが階層構造により格納されているデータベースからエミュレーションに必要なデータを取得する場合において、エミュレーションに必要なデータが不足した状態でエミュレーションが実行されてしまうことを回避できるようにしたエミュレーションシステムを提供する。
【課題を解決するための手段】
【0007】
本開示に係るエミュレーションシステム10は、実機における動作を実機以外の動作環境においてエミュレーションするエミュレーションシステムであって、複数種類のデータが階層構造により格納されているデータベース12と、前記エミュレーションに必要なデータを前記データベースから取得する取得部21と、前記取得部により取得されたデータを用いて前記エミュレーションを実行する実行部22と、前記エミュレーションに必要な全てのデータのうち前記取得部により取得されていない不足データが存在するか否かを確認する確認部23と、を備え、前記実行部は、前記確認部により前記不足データが存在しないことが確認されると、前記エミュレーションを実行する。
【0008】
本開示に係るエミュレーションシステム10によれば、複数種類のデータが階層構造により格納されているデータベース12からエミュレーションに必要なデータを取得する場合において、不足データが存在しないことを確認した上でエミュレーションを行うことができ、エミュレーションに必要なデータが不足した状態でエミュレーションが実行されてしまうことを回避することができる。
【図面の簡単な説明】
【0009】
本開示の一実施形態に係るエミュレーションシステムの構成例を概略的に示すブロック図
本開示の一実施形態に係るデータベースのデータ構造の一例を概略的に示す図
本開示の一実施形態に係るエミュレータのソフトウェア構成の一例を概略的に示すブロック図
本開示の一実施形態に係るエミュレーションシステムによる制御フローの一例を概略的に示すフローチャート
【発明を実施するための形態】
【0010】
以下、本開示のエミュレーションシステムに係る実施形態の一例について図面を参照しながら説明する。図1に例示するエミュレーションシステム10は、実機における動作を実機以外の動作環境において仮想検証つまりエミュレーションするためのシステムであって、エミュレータ11およびデータベース12を備える。エミュレータ11とデータベース12との接続は、有線接続であってもよいし、無線接続であってもよいし、エミュレータ11とデータベース12との間に例えばネットワーク通信網などが介在された接続形態であってもよい。エミュレーションシステム10は、エミュレータ11およびデータベース12を備える単一の装置として構成されていてもよい。
(【0011】以降は省略されています)
この特許をJ-PlatPatで参照する
関連特許
株式会社デンソー
検出装置
18日前
株式会社デンソー
診断装置
8日前
株式会社デンソー
表示装置
16日前
株式会社デンソー
駆動回路
5日前
株式会社デンソー
演算装置
8日前
株式会社デンソー
熱交換器
1日前
株式会社デンソー
回転電機
8日前
株式会社デンソー
測距装置
8日前
株式会社デンソー
回転電機
17日前
株式会社デンソー
光干渉計
16日前
株式会社デンソー
光学部材
10日前
株式会社デンソー
検出装置
1日前
株式会社デンソー
送受信装置
17日前
株式会社デンソー
半導体装置
5日前
株式会社デンソー
半導体装置
5日前
株式会社デンソー
半導体装置
5日前
株式会社デンソー
半導体装置
5日前
株式会社デンソー
半導体装置
8日前
株式会社デンソー
半導体装置
5日前
株式会社デンソー
半導体装置
8日前
株式会社デンソー
半導体装置
5日前
株式会社デンソー
半導体装置
5日前
株式会社デンソー
レーダ装置
8日前
株式会社デンソー
レーダ装置
8日前
株式会社デンソー
レーダ装置
8日前
株式会社デンソー
電子制御装置
1日前
株式会社デンソー
車両制御装置
16日前
株式会社デンソー
演算システム
16日前
株式会社デンソー
電力変換装置
1日前
株式会社デンソー
電力供給装置
8日前
株式会社デンソー
潅水システム
1日前
株式会社デンソー
電力供給装置
8日前
株式会社デンソーテン
電源制御装置
2日前
株式会社デンソー
充電計画装置
8日前
株式会社デンソー
位置検出装置
16日前
株式会社デンソー
基板支持構造体
1日前
続きを見る
他の特許を見る